In 1980, Elizabeth Blackburn discovered that telomeres have a particular DNA. In 1982, together with Jack Szostak, she further proved that this DNA prevents chromosomes from being broken down. Elizabeth Blackburn and Carol Greider discovered the enzyme telomerase, which produces the telomeres…
Elizabeth Blackburn’s research on telomeres began in the early 1980s when she sequenced the ends of DNA in small pond-dwelling organisms. Her work is responsible for the discovery that cellular aging is not strictly determined by genetics and earned her a Nobel Prize in 2009.

Elizabeth Blackburn and Carol Greider discovered the enzyme, telomerase, that makes and can replenish the telomeric sequences at the ends of DNA. These initial discoveries used simple, single-celled organisms and lots of radiolabeling. In 1980, Elizabeth Blackburn discovered that telomeres have a particular DNA. In 1982, together with Jack Szostak, she further proved that this DNA prevents chromosomes from being broken down. Elizabeth Blackburn and Carol Greider discovered the enzyme telomerase, which produces the telomeres' DNA, in 1984. Dr. Elizabeth H. Blackburn, Morris Herztein Professor of Biology and Physiology in the Department of Biochemistry and Biophysics at the University of California, San Francisco, is a leader in the area of telomere and telomerase research.
